A wave of passion from gamers emerges about long-lost franchises, reigniting discussions around nostalgic titles fans wish would return. As 2025 unfolds, voices on forums passionately identify their favorites, showcasing a nostalgic yearning.

Franchises in Demand

Many gamers are vocal about their desires for familiar series to make a comeback. Here are the top picks:

  • C&C (Command & Conquer) tops the list for its strategic gameplay.

  • Infamous and Syphon Filter were also mentioned, indicating a craving for rich storytelling and action.

  • F-Zero and Deus Ex capture imaginations with hopes for sequels that could fulfill long-held narratives.

One user expressed, "C&C is my number one choice," emphasizing the emotional investment tied to these games. Another lamented about the stalled Timesplitters remake, saying, "It's been in works for like 20 years; Iโ€™ve given up on it ever seeing a release."

Game Impact and Sentiment

Interestingly, many of these titles represent a cross-section of genres and gameplay styles. Responses showed a blend of frustration and optimism. For instance, while many want to revive franchises like Killzone and Sly Cooper, hopes for titles like Battle for Middle Earth and Rogue Squadron reveal nostalgia for franchises tied to memorable gameplay experiences.

A prominent sentiment among users is a desire for resolution in stories left hanging. A comment read, "I still want Mankind Divided 2 to wrap up the story of Adam Jensen."
